Mold Restoration in Frisco, TX
Mold restoration services involve the removal and cleanup of mold growth from residential properties, helping to restore a healthy indoor environment. This process typically addresses issues such as water damage, high humidity, or previous mold infestations, covering projects like attic mold removal, bathroom mold remediation, basement cleanup, and repairs to prevent future growth. Property owners often want to understand the extent of mold contamination, the potential health impacts, and the steps involved in safely eliminating mold from affected areas.
Before requesting mold restoration, homeowners should assess the visible presence of mold, any musty odors, and signs of water leaks or moisture issues. It’s important to identify the scope of the problem, including hidden mold behind walls or under flooring, and to consider the materials impacted. Understanding the procedures used for mold removal, the importance of moisture control, and the need for thorough cleaning and drying can help property owners make informed decisions about restoring a safe and healthy living space.

Mold Restoration Questions
What causes mold to grow indoors? Mold develops in areas with excess moisture, such as leaks, high humidity, or poor ventilation.
How can mold affect property health? Mold can cause allergies, respiratory issues, and other health concerns for occupants.
What are common signs of mold presence? Visible spots, musty odors, or water damage are typical indicators of mold growth.
What areas are most vulnerable to mold in a home? Bathrooms, basements, attics, and around windows are common spots for mold development.
